| Official Title | Agreement for scientific and technological cooperation between the European Community and the Government of the United States of America - Intellectual property |
| Type of Agreement | Bilateral |
| Place of Signature | Washington |
| Date of Signature | 05/12/1997 |
| Date of Entry Into Force | 14/10/1998 |
| Duration | Definite |
| Objective of Agreement | The Parties shall encourage, develop and facilitate cooperative activities in fields of common interest where they are pursuing research and development activities in science and technology. |
| Remarks | With a duration until 13 October 2003, it has been renewed for an additional period of five years until October 2008 by the Agreement renewing the Agreement for scientific and technological cooperation between the European Community and the Government of the United States of America (OJ L335 of 11/11/2004, p.7).
This cooperation agreement is based on mutual benefits and an exchange of information. The areas of cooperation covered include: the environment, biomedicine and health, agriculture, engineering research, non-nuclear energy, natural resources, material sciences and metrology, information and communication technologies, telematics, biotechnology, marine sciences and technology, social sciences research, transport, science and technology policy, management, training and mobility of scientists. Cooperation activities may take the form of joint task forces, joint studies, joint organisation of seminars and conferences, exchanges of equipment and materials, visits of scientists, engineers or other appropriate personnel, exchange of scientific and technical information. Implementing arrangements govern specific areas of cooperation. |
